  4. 16. Apr. 2024 · And as fate would have it, he achieved his latest career milestone right where it all began. Gray earned the 100th win of his Major League career in Monday's 3-1 win over the A's at the Coliseum -- where he also picked up his first win more than 10 years ago -- on Jackie Robinson Day.
